    360 GO

    360 GO runs for a full calendar year and has been designed in consultation with clinical and educational experts, alongside valuable insights from previous Graduates. Our aim is to provide you with a nurturing, encouraging, and highly personalised journey. Here's a glimpse of what your Graduate year looks like at National 360:

    • Week 1 - Simulated Practice: Our Simulated Practice sessions provide a safe and controlled environment to practice your therapeutic skills and get comfortable with real-life scenarios before your first client session. Week 1 allows you to experiment, make mistakes, and learn from them.
    • Weeks 2-12 – Experiential Discovery: The best way to master the art of therapy is through experiential discovery – a dynamic, hands-on approach that immerses you in real-life situations. Weeks 2-12 are all about connecting new information to existing knowledge, with everyday applications to enhance the learning process.
    • Weeks 13-26 – Theoretical Learning: Develop your clinical expertise by strengthening your theoretical foundation through engaging in immersive and interactive workshops facilitated by Speech Pathology subject matter experts.
    • Weeks 27-52 – Individualised Development: A custom program will be designed with you so you can follow your preferred roadmap to excellence. Specialise in Paediatrics, Adult Neuro, Dysphagia or Complex Communication, dive into our L&D Programs for leadership roles or maintain a diverse caseload. We'll be with you each step along the way.

    Supervision & Support

    We are well known for providing the most comprehensive supervision & support in the industry, complemented by ancillary learning opportunities to coach and develop the best Allied Health professionals in Australia. The support you receive as a 360 Graduate includes:

    • Observational sessions – before you take on your first client, you will have the opportunity to observe the end-to-end client process through observing experienced therapists within your local team.
    • Joint appointments – your initial client sessions will be completed with your Clinical Supervisor, who will provide you with real-time support and feedback to refine your approach.
    • Self-directed learning – our online library has been developed over many years by our Clinical Practice Advisors and Clinical Leads, covering every topic you can think of Your Clinical Supervisor and Team Leader will guide you on the best learnings relevant to your interests, skills, experience level and caseload.
    • 2 hours of weekly Clinical Supervision – meet with your supervisor 1:1 each week to discuss your caseload, attend group supervision to engage in peer learning, and receive behind-the-scenes support to review your reports & therapy plans.
    • Weekly Team Leader Support – meet with your Team Leader 1:1 to support your understanding of organisational procedures, set achievable goals to work towards, and discuss your wellbeing and work/life balance.
    • Unlimited mentoring – our Clinical Practice Advisors host over a dozen mentoring sessions each week. CPAs share their knowledge through educational presentations, Q&A sessions, and providing 1:1 clinical consultations for the national team.
